The figure’s gaze is directed towards the viewer, exhibiting an expression that blends serenity with a hint of introspection. The lighting highlights her face, drawing attention to her dark hair and the subtle nuances of her features. A sense of intimacy is created by this direct engagement with the observer.
To the lower right corner, a small table holds a decorative vase and several oranges. These objects introduce an element of still life into the scene, adding visual interest and potentially suggesting themes of abundance or domesticity. The muted color palette – primarily earth tones punctuated by the green fabric and the vibrant orange fruit – contributes to a sense of quiet luxury and understated elegance.
The setting appears to be an interior space, though details are minimal. The background is dark, which serves to isolate the figure and intensify the focus on her form. This deliberate restriction of context allows for a concentrated examination of the subject’s physical presence and psychological state.
Subtly, the work seems to explore themes of beauty, leisure, and perhaps even vulnerability. The models pose and expression invite contemplation about the female body as an object of aesthetic appreciation while also hinting at a deeper emotional complexity. The inclusion of the still life elements introduces a layer of symbolic meaning that could be interpreted in various ways – as representations of earthly pleasures or as reminders of transience.
